Frédéric Chopin

Frédéric Chopin

Frédéric Chopin was born March 1, 1810, in the village of Zelazowa Wola, Duchy of Warsaw, to a Polish mother and a French-expatriate father. His extraordinary musical abilities were recognized at an early age and he was quickly hailed as a child prodigy by his homeland. Chopin left Poland forever at the age of twenty and became one of the great composers and pianists in European classical music.

His musical talent was apparent from a young age, and he gained a reputation as a “second Mozart” in Warsaw. He began giving public charity concerts when he was just seven years old, and his first piano lessons were received from his older sister Ludwika. He also published two polonaises (G minor and B flat major) at the engraving workshop of Father Cybulski, director of a School of Organists and one of the few music publishers in Poland. His childhood performances for aristocratic salons even earned him a question of what the audience liked best; to which the witty seven-year-old replied, “My shirt collar.”

Carl Friedrich Gauss

Carl Friedrich Gauss

Carl Friedrich Gauss was an incredible child prodigy, born on April 30th, 1777. Numerous tales exist detailing his incredibly precocious behavior as a toddler, and he had made several groundbreaking discoveries in mathematics before even becoming a teenager. The pinnacle of his work was the completion of Disquisitiones Arithmeticae, regarded as his magnum opus, at the age of 21. Though his work wasn’t published until 1801, it was fundamental in establishing number theory as an academic discipline and still shapes the field even today.

Gauss was known by many names, such as “the prince of mathematicians” and “greatest mathematician since antiquity”, due to his incredible influence over various areas of mathematics and science. He is often tallied among the most influential mathematicians of all time.

Gauss also made several other contributions to mathematics, including the development of methods for computing the orbits of asteroids. Gauss contributed to astronomy by furthering the development of a regular polygon with a large number of sides that could be used to calculate the orbits of planets. Gauss also developed the Gaussian distribution, which is still used in many areas of mathematics, including statistics and probability theory.

Additionally, he laid down the foundations for differential geometry and topology. His ideas were so advanced that some parts of his work remained neglected until the 20th century.

Lope de Vega

Lope De Vega

Lope de Vega (25 November 1562 – 27 August 1635) was a Spanish Baroque playwright and poet of immense talent who is renowned for his vast literary output. His works, both in volume and quality, stand in comparison to none but the works of Cervantes himself – 1,500 to 2,500 plays of which some 425 have survived until the present day. Prodigiously gifted from a young age, Lope was reading Spanish and Latin by five years old, translating Latin verse at ten, and writing his first play at twelve.

In his fourteenth year, he enrolled in the Colegio Imperial, a Jesuit school in Madrid, though this would be short-lived as his propensity for adventure drew him to a military expedition in Portugal. His literary genius was evident in the quality and range of his works, from old romance couplets to rare lyrical combinations borrowed from Italy. Lope himself declared that he had created a path through Spanish poetry for those who should come after him – a path that they could simply follow. Yehudi Menuhin

Yehudi Menuhin

Yehudi Menuhin was an incredible prodigy, starting his violin instruction at the young age of three under the tutelage of Sigmund Anker. By seven years old, he had already made his solo debut with the San Francisco Symphony in 1923. His studies continued under the Romanian composer and violinist George Enescu and included sessions with the renowned Louis Persinger and Adolf Busch.

Menuhin was also known for his acts of reconciliation during World War II. He used music to spread a message of peace, performing for allied soldiers and accompanying composer Benjamin Britten to the Bergen-Belsen concentration camp after its liberation in April 1945. This made him the first Jewish musician to perform in Germany after the Holocaust. In 1947, he conducted a performance with conductor Wilhelm Furtwängler as an act of reconciliation. This act was seen as a major step forward in terms of healing the wounds caused by World War II and restoring peace between those who had been enemies during the war.

John von Neumann

John Von Neumann

John von Neumann was one of the most remarkable mathematicians in history, renowned for his contributions to a wide range of mathematical fields including quantum physics, functional analysis, set theory, topology, economics, computer science, numerical analysis, and hydrodynamics. Born on December 28th, 1903 in Austria-Hungary, he was the son of Max Neumann, a lawyer who worked in a bank, and Margaret Kann. Prodigiously gifted from an early age, at only six years old he was able to divide two 8-digit numbers accurately in his head.

At the age of 23, he had already earned his Ph.D. in mathematics with minors in experimental physics and chemistry from the University of Budapest. He went on to make further groundbreaking contributions in each of these fields and many more, enabling advances that revolutionized the world. His legacy is still felt today.

Jean-François Champollion

Jean-François Champollion

Jean-François Champollion was born on December 23, 1790, in Figeac, France, the last of seven children. His exceptional linguistic abilities were evident from a young age – by 16, he had mastered 12 languages and delivered a paper on the Coptic language to the Grenoble Academy. By 20, he could also speak Latin, Greek, Hebrew, Amharic, Sanskrit, Avestan, Pahlavi, Arabic, Syriac, Chaldean, Persian, Ethiopic, and Chinese.

Champollion is best known for his work on deciphering Egyptian hieroglyphs, which were first studied by Silvestre de Sacy, Johan David Akerblad, Thomas Young, and William John Bankes. With their groundwork in place, Champollion was able to make a major breakthrough when he translated parts of the Rosetta Stone in 1822, demonstrating that the written Egyptian language was similar to Coptic and that it was composed of both phonetic and ideographic symbols. Moved by this, Champollion was able to unlock the mysteries of an ancient language and make a lasting contribution to Egyptology. Maria Gaetana Agnesi

Maria Gaetana Agnesi

Maria Gaetana Agnesi was an incredibly talented and multi-faceted individual. Born in Milan, Italy in 1718, she showed immense promise at an early age. By the time she was five years old she could already speak French and Italian fluently, and by her thirteenth birthday she had acquired a mastery of Greek, Hebrew, Spanish, German, Latin, and likely several more languages. Her proficiency in language earned her the nickname of “The Walking Polyglot”. But it was her aptitude for mathematics that truly set Agnesi apart from her peers; at just nine years old she composed and presented an hour-long address in Latin to an academic gathering, discussing the right of women to be educated.

Proving her brilliance, Agnesi went on to publish a book on both differential and integral calculus – a first in its field – and was later appointed an honorary member of the faculty at the University of Bologna. To honor her impressive contributions to science, a crater on Venus has been named in her honor. Truly, Maria Gaetana Agnesi was an astonishing prodigy!

Blaise Pascal

Blaise Pascal

Blaise Pascal was a French mathematician, physicist, inventor, writer, and Christian philosopher. At the young age of 11 or 12, he had secretly worked out the first twenty-three propositions of Euclid on his own. His brilliance was evident from a young age and he was recognized as an exceptional prodigy in his field. He received an education from his father and was able to make significant contributions to the world of mathematics, physics, and philosophy.

Pascal is credited with helping create two major areas of research: projective geometry and probability theory. His work on the scientific method helped define modern scientific principles for many years after his death in 1662. Pascal’s brilliance can still be seen today in the form of Pascal’s triangle, Pascal’s law (an important principle of hydrostatics), and the SI unit of pressure named after him. He also influenced modern economics and social science through his work on probability theory. A programming language was even created in honor of his scientific contributions and is still used to this day.

Pablo Picasso

Pablo Picasso

Pablo Picasso was one of the most renowned figures in 20th-century art, particularly known for his co-founding of cubism with Georges Braque. Picasso’s father had started training him in art before 1890 and a collection of early works held by the Museu Picasso in Barcelona shows the progress he made during his young years. By 1894, Picasso had started his career as a painter and his remarkable talent was showcased in ‘The First Communion’, a painting that depicted his sister Lola and was completed when he was only 14 years old.

Similarly impressive is the portrait of Aunt Pepa which Juan-Eduardo Cirlot has called “one of the greatest in the whole history of Spanish painting”. Picasso was a child prodigy and even at the tender age of nine, he had already produced the stunning artwork ‘Le picador’, demonstrating his remarkable ability at an early age.

Wolfgang Amadeus Mozart

Wolfgang Amadeus Mozart

Wolfgang Amadeus Mozart (January 27, 1756 – December 5, 1791) was a prodigy in every sense of the word. Born to Leopold Mozart (1719-1787), deputy Kapellmeister to the court orchestra of the Archbishop of Salzburg, and himself a minor composer, young Wolfgang was quickly exposed to music theory and composition. Leopold encouraged his daughter, Nannerl Mozart, to take up piano lessons from a young age; he even wrote a successful violin textbook called Versuch einer grà¼ndlichen Violinschule.

While he taught her, Wolfgang watched with fascination, showing early signs of musical aptitude. Nannerl later noted that at just three years old, Wolfgang “often spent much time at the clavier, picking out thirds” and displaying pleasure when it sounded good to him. Leopold decided to teach Wolfgang a few minuets and pieces on the keyboard at four years old; Nannerl recalled he “could play it faultlessly and with the greatest delicacy, and keeping exactly in time.” By five years old Wolfgang was already composing little pieces which Leopold wrote down.

By the end of his lifetime, Mozart had composed over 600 works that are widely celebrated as some of the most remarkable symphonic, operatic, concertante, chamber, and choral pieces that were ever written. His music is still hugely popular today and continues to be performed regularly all over the world.
